Spotlight 400 m ftir imaging system

Manufactured by PerkinElmer
Sourced in United States

The Spotlight 400 m-FTIR imaging system is a high-performance Fourier-transform infrared (FTIR) imaging spectrometer designed for advanced materials analysis. The system utilizes a motorized, diffraction-limited infrared (IR) microscope to collect detailed spectral and spatial information from samples.

Fresh Frozen Tissue FT-IR Imaging

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
The spotlight 400 m-FTIR imaging system (PerkinElmer, Inc., Waltham, MA, USA) was used to analyze the fresh frozen tissue sections without decalcification which were washed with water to remove the embedding medium (O.C.T compound) and dried naturally. The resolution of spectral acquisition was 4 cm−1, ranging from 650 to 4000 cm−1, and 36 scans were used for each sample. Spectrum software (PerkinElmer, Inc.) was used to obtain the absorption wavelengths.

Paraffin Section Analysis via m-FTIR

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
The spotlight 400 m-FTIR imaging system (PerkinElmer, Inc., Waltham, MA, USA) was used to analyze the para n sections naturally dried after hydration. The resolution of spectral acquisition was 4 cm - 1 , ranging from 650 to 4000 cm - 1 , and 36 scans were used for each sample. Spectrum software (PerkinElmer, Inc.) was used to obtain the absorption wavelengths.
